Posted By: mrlumpy Robot SPAMMERs killing my site - 08/19/2006 10:28 AM
Hello all,

Robots posting spam signups and messages are driving me insane. They signup using some sort of spam script I assume and post obscene messages, viagra and gambling messages.

Is there a quick change I can make to the UBB program files to stop these spam-bots? I would love some simple change in the signup and posting pages to make the spam-bots incompatible with my tweaked board.

Thanks for any assistance. If I figure out anything, I'll post it of course.

smile
Posted By: AllenAyres Re: Robot SPAMMERs killing my site - 08/19/2006 7:56 PM
What version (and script) are you using?

First I'd make sure flood protection is turned on, then email verification is on for new registrations.
Posted By: mrlumpy Re: Robot SPAMMERs killing my site - 08/20/2006 12:30 AM
Hi AllenAyres,

Thanks for replying. I'm using UBB.classic 6.7.2 with flood protection on.

A lot of my members are very computer un-savvy, and they have trouble with the signup process. Quite unlike the skill-level of UBBDev members...so, email verification is beyond most of them.

Is there a change to the GET or POST line in a UBB script that will allow me to universally change the name of the "submit" variable involved, so that pre-made spam scripts fail?

Posted By: AllenAyres Re: Robot SPAMMERs killing my site - 08/21/2006 3:56 AM
hmmm.. email verification just sends the new users a link to click on, should be pretty simple if they are able to post in a forum smile Barring that about your only choice is to turn on registration moderation and approve each new user.

I'm not so sure about changing the post or get variables, everything is so interconnected. You may consider moving to threads, threads has an http referrer check that will only allow posts from within the actual forum, not sent from a spambot off-site
Posted By: Painfool Re: Robot SPAMMERs killing my site - 10/19/2006 4:08 PM
The main problem with Email verification these days are spam filters frown had to turn mine back on due to the script spammers as well.
